Full Job Description
Position Summary

The Manager, Financial Reporting and Technical Accounting manages the Company's recurring financial reporting to its parent company, lenders, and other stakeholders and supports SEC reporting and technical accounting activities. Reporting to the Director of SEC and Financial Reporting, this role oversees financial statements and disclosures under U.S. GAAP and IFRS, maintains related reporting controls, and partners across the organization to ensure compliance with applicable reporting requirements.

Responsibilities:
  • Prepare quarterly reporting package for a parent company, including footnote disclosures, statements of cash flows and stockholders' equity, and related supporting schedules
  • Manage recurring reporting to banks, including financial disclosures and compliance with covenants.
  • Assist with the preparation of SEC filings, including Forms 10-Q, 10-K, Proxy Statements, registration statements, and coordinating XBRL requirements.
  • Assist with statutory reporting for international subsidiaries, including coordination with accounting team and external auditors
  • Research and document technical accounting and disclosure matters arising through the reporting process and prepare memoranda as needed
  • Monitor new accounting standards and SEC regulations, assess reporting implications, and support implementation
  • Maintain disclosure controls, internal controls over financial reporting, process documentation, and supporting evidence related to external reporting
  • Develop and manage strong, collaborative relationships with peers in finance and business partners across the organization to understand the business and apply that knowledge to the financial statements and reporting
  • Work closely with external auditors, business leaders and senior management to ensure communication of critical issues in a timely manner
  • Leverage AI and automation tools to streamline reporting, data analysis, reconciliations and technical-accounting research, while maintaining appropriate review controls

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in accounting or finance required
  • Minimum 6 years of relevant experience in public accounting, SEC reporting, or financial reporting for a publicly traded company
  • CPA required; experience with a Big 4 or national public accounting firm preferred
  • Strong knowledge of U.S. GAAP, SEC reporting requirements, financial statements, footnote disclosures, and MD&A
  • Experience preparing or reviewing statements of cash flows, earnings per share, and stockholders' equity
  • Ability to research accounting literature and translate complex matters into clear conclusions and disclosures
  • Experience with complex ERP and consolidation systems preferred
  • Advanced Microsoft Excel and project management skills, with the ability to manage multiple priorities and critical deadlines
  • Clear communication, sound judgment, strong attention to detail, and the ability to work effectively across functions and organizational levels
